A Canadian Minister’s Speech Shows a Growing Divide With the U.S.

The New York Times Original article ›
LyrArc Article Gist
Canada's foreign minister in a speech in parliament says Canada will now "set its own clear and sovereign course." This follows a speech by Angela Merkel of Germany saying " the times in which we could fully rely on others, they are somewhat over." Both countries plan to take a bigger role in international affairs as the U.S. under president Trump is seen as not being able to or not wanting to lead. The U.S. withdrawal from the Paris climate change accord has shaken confidence in the U.S. role in international affairs in 2017.

Justin Trudeau of the Liberal Party as the new prime minister of Canada in November 2015

10/20/2015

Trudeau leads the Liberals to an impressive win with an absolute majority, 184 seats in the Canadian parliament, winning big in Ontario and Quebec.
